What happens when your peaceful suburban neighborhood suddenly turns into a prehistoric battleground? That's the premise of The End of Oak Street, a bonkers new sci-fi action movie starring Anne Hathaway and Ewan McGregor. The first trailer has just dropped, and it's a wild ride from start to finish.
The clip opens with Hathaway and McGregor as a typical suburban couple, driving with their kids in a minivan. But their mundane errand takes a terrifying turn when dinosaurs—yes, actual dinosaurs—begin rampaging through the streets. The trailer cuts between frantic car chases, crumbling houses, and close calls with massive claws and teeth. It's chaos, but with a surprisingly emotional core.
Directed by up-and-coming filmmaker Jordan Vogt-Roberts, The End of Oak Street promises to blend high-octane action with family drama. The trailer hints at a deeper story about survival and the lengths parents will go to protect their children. In one scene, McGregor's character yells, "We have to keep moving!" as a T-Rex looms behind them. In another, Hathaway's character clutches her kids, her face a mix of terror and determination.

While the trailer keeps much of the plot under wraps, it's clear that The End of Oak Street is aiming for a mix of Jurassic Park-style thrills and edge-of-your-seat action that keeps audiences guessing.
For fans of dinosaur movies, this looks like a fresh take. Instead of a remote island or a secret lab, the prehistoric creatures invade a modern suburb, turning everyday locations like schools and grocery stores into death traps. The trailer shows a school bus overturned, a gas station exploding, and a family hiding in a basement as a raptor sniffs around. It's terrifying, but also oddly relatable—what would you do if a dinosaur showed up on your street?
Hathaway and McGregor bring star power and gravitas to the project. Hathaway, known for her roles in The Devil Wears Prada and Interstellar, brings a grounded intensity to her character. McGregor, fresh off his acclaimed turn in Obi-Wan Kenobi, plays the everyman dad who must become a hero. Their chemistry is palpable, even in the short trailer.
The visual effects look impressive, with dinosaurs rendered in stunning detail. From the scaly skin of a T-Rex to the swift movements of a pack of raptors, the creatures feel real and menacing. The trailer also teases some inventive action sequences, including a chase through a collapsing house and a standoff on a highway bridge.
The End of Oak Street is set to hit theaters later this year. With its unique premise and A-list cast, it's already generating buzz as one of the most anticipated action movies of 2026. If the trailer is any indication, audiences are in for a thrilling, heart-pounding ride.
